  • Aug 10, 2010
    Warner Bros. releases Blake Shelton's album "All About Tonight"
    Aug 17, 2010
    Miranda Lambert is a surprise guest at the Grand Ole Opry, joining Blake Shelton on "Home" at Nashville's War Memorial Auditorium
    Aug 23, 2010
    Blake Shelton sits in as guest co-host of NBC's "Today" show
    Aug 28, 2010
    Blake Shelton's "All About Tonight" hits #1 on the Billboard country albums chart
    Aug 28, 2010
    Blake Shelton's "All About Tonight" starts a three-week run at #1 on the Billboard country singles chart
    Sep 1, 2010
    ABC airs "CMA Music Festival: Country's Night To Rock," hosted by Tim McGraw with Lady Antebellum, Blake Shelton, Kellie Pickler, Trace Adkins, Reba McEntire, Keith Urban and Jason Aldean
    Sep 2, 2010
    Reprise releases Blake Shelton's "Who Are You When I'm Not Looking" to radio
    Oct 13, 2010
    Blake Shelton launches his first headlining tour at the Ogden Theatre in Denver
    Oct 20, 2010
    Blake Shelton headlines at Club Nokia in Los Angeles, where Miranda Lambert makes a surprise appearance on "Home." In the audience: Kelly Clarkson, Chelsea Handler and Scott and Renee Baio
    Oct 23, 2010
    Blake Shelton becomes a member of the Grand Ole Opry. For his big night, he performs "All About Tonight," "She Wouldn't Be Gone" and "Home" and duets with Trace Adkins on "Hillbilly Bone"
